WebIn celestial mechanics, the product of G and the mass of the Earth, M, is known as the Standard Gravitational Parameter, which is denoted by μ. In other words, μ = GM = 398600.4418 km3/s2 Unfortunately, because the value of G is not known with a high degree of certainty, this uncertainty level carries over to the Standard Gravitational Parameter.
